Job description

Overview

Systems Planning and Analysis, Inc. (SPA) delivers high-impact, technical solutions to complex national security issues. With over 50 years of business expertise and consistent growth, we are known for continuous innovation for our government customers, in both the US and abroad. Our exceptionally talented team is highly collaborative in spirit and practice, producing Results that Matter. Come work with the best! We offer opportunity, unique challenges, and clear-sighted commitment to the mission. SPA: Objective. Responsive. Trusted.

The Joint, Office of the Secretary of Defense, Interagency Division provides expert support services to a range of customers spanning across the Department of Defense, Federal Civilian, and international markets. JOID provides a diverse portfolio of analytical and programmatic capabilities to help our customers make informed decisions on their most challenging issues. The Acquisition and Technology Analysis Group within JOID specializes in the application of multi‑disciplinary analytic skills to support multiple clients within the Department of War (DoW). These clients include the Office of the Under Secretary of War for Research and Engineering (OUSW(R&E)), Office of the Under Secretary of War for Acquisition and Sustainment (OUSW(A&S)), DARPA, the Joint Staff, and USINDOPACOM. SPA provides critical decision support to enabling and executing a strategy of technological superiority and enabling the delivery and sustainment of secure, resilient, and preeminent capabilities to the warfighter quickly and cost effectively. Our team of experienced military, technical, and operations research analysts is skilled in evaluating military problems, identifying the driving factors, devising innovative approaches, collecting applicable data, developing necessary software tools, and performing thorough and timely assessments to inform technology and acquisition governance decisions to ensure U.S. military forces retain military superiority in the future.

Responsibilities

We are seeking a highly proactive, detail‑driven Sr. Operations Manager to provide technical management, leadership, and exceptional executive‑level support to the front office operations of senior OUSD(R&E) leadership. I will oversee and manage daily operations, lead continuous process improvement, workflow mapping, and resource allocation to ensure the timely, high‑quality execution of all taskings and operational requirements. Develop and track assignments, design and implement organizational support systems, recommend knowledge‑management technologies, and create management tools that enhance coordination and workflow transparency across the enterprise. Conduct staffing and operational analyses, implementing process efficiencies, and developing standard operating procedures that strengthen organizational performance. Evaluate programs against strategic objectives, establish performance metrics, and provide actionable recommendations to senior leaders for improving effectiveness and mission alignment. Lead project planning and management activities, including the development of project artifacts, facilitation of team meetings, and synchronization of cross‑functional efforts. Support senior government clients with structured decision‑making frameworks, and provide personnel management and strategic planning support as needed.

Qualifications
Required
  • 10+ years of experience.
  • Bachelor’s degree in a management or technical discipline.
  • Proven experience in technical management and leadership, specifically in front office operations within government or military environments, with a strong ability to interface with personnel at various levels, from action officers to senior leaders.
  • Demonstrated expertise in workflow management, process improvement, and organizational efficiency, including the ability to develop standard operating procedures and implement knowledge management technologies.
  • Strong skills in project planning and management, including the ability to create project artifacts such as plans, schedules, and status reports, alongside experience in performance metrics development and resource allocation.
  • Mastery of management tools, including MS Office suite.
  • Active TS/SCI clearance.
  • Able to work fully onsite based on client needs.
Desired
  • Experience and skills in project management, operational management, strategy development and planning, and executive decision support.
  • Advanced program management education or certificate.
  • Demonstrated ability to assess urgency and prioritize work assignments, determine optimal courses of action, and manage actions to timely execution.
